Evaluation of rice (Oryza sativa L.) hybrids under Agro-climatic conditions of Prayagraj

Author(s):
Erigi Jayasree, Vikram Singh and Sujeet Kumar
Abstract:
For the growing population and increased urbanization there is a need of the best hybrids that obtain highest yields and also effectively utilize the available land, which will be possible through better breeding programmes, best agronomic practices and their peculiar agro-climatic conditions for which an experiment was conducted during Kharif season of 2020 at Crop Research Farm, Department of Agronomy, SHUATS, Prayagraj (UP) to study the “Evaluation of Rice Hybrids under Agro-climatic conditions of Prayagraj”. The experiment was laid out in Randomized Block Design consisting of 15 Rice hybrids each replicated thrice. The different Rice hybrids were allocated randomly in each replication. The result revealed that hybrid (KR-15) was found to be best for obtaining Maximum plant height (113.04 cm), more number of tillers/hill (16.93), more number of tillers/m2 (439.00), maximum dry weight (47.07g), maximum panicle length (29.47 cm), more number of filled grains/panicle (135.62), maximum test weight (23.00 g), maximum grain yield/hill (22.93 g), maximum grain yield (9.47 t/ha), maximum stover yield (31.33 t/ha), maximum biological weight (23.04 t/ha), maxim harvest index (46.23%). Highest gross return (1,89,400.00 INR/ha), net return (1,28,843.00 INR/ha) and B:C ratio (2:13) was also recorded hybrid (KR-15) respectively.
